According to multiple sources:
- A small tree-sprig has already appeared at the “Creepy Camps” location—likely a teaser.
- Datamines reveal characters like Kang & Kodos, NPCs, and code referencing Springfield’s power plant and other landmarks.
- A full map transformation is reportedly incoming, with a cel-shaded aesthetic matching The Simpsons.
- The collaboration is likely scheduled for early November 2025.
In short, Fortnite’s next “mini-season” appears to be centered on The Simpsons, turning Springfield into a live-action battleground.
Key Features
Here are the likely highlights of the update:
| Feature | Details |
|---|---|
| Map overhaul | The island becomes Springfield, including Evergreen Terrace, Moe’s Tavern, the nuclear power plant. |
| Cel–shaded aesthetics | Visual style matches The Simpsons cartoon. |
| Character skins | Homer, Marge, Bart, Ned Flanders, Krusty, Moe. |
| Special encounters | Rare spawn of Kang & Kodos during matches. |
| Teaser content | Bart’s treehouse located at Creepy Camps—players expect clues and quests there. |

Recent Updates
Here are the most recent confirmed or leaked updates (as of October 2025):
- Oct 19, 2025: Leakers such as @HYPEX publish mini-season map previews, citing Springfield takeover.
- Oct 24, 2025: Key-art leak shows skins for Homer, Marge, Bart, Ned Flanders and more.
- Leaks: Suggest special spawn chance event with Kang & Kodos.
- Estimated Launch: Early November 2025 – probably Nov 1 or following a live map event.
